  • 8. In the previous lesson, it was discussed that to set up a computer network there are several computer network tools, materials, testing device and equipment are used.
  • 9. Networking tool Picture Description/Uses 1. Crimper (Crimping tool) a device used to crimp the RJ45 connector to the UTP cable. The result of the tool's work is called a crimp. 2. RJ45 Connector an 8-pin connection used for Ethernet network adapters. Short for Registered Jack-45 3. Network Cable a popular type of cable used in computer networking that consists of two shielded wires twisted around each other. Also known as Unshielded Twisted Pair (UTP). 4. Network Cable Tester A device that is used to test the strength and connectivity of a particular type of cable or other wired assemblies.
